Management Meeting Minutes — Dray Street Lease

Attendees: ops, finance, facilities. Quick recap for the incoming director: we're renegotiating the Dray Street lease with Pelham Holdings before the March renewal. Facilities thinks we can trim rent by shrinking to two floors; finance wants a shorter term. Nobody loves the break clause as drafted. Next step is a counteroffer draft by Thursday. Context on why this matters follows.

board note of bajop-yaweg: The western region missed its Pelys quota by 58.0 percent last quarter. Pelysek Foods plans to raise the Belius list price by 44.0 percent in July. The steering committee signed off on a budget of $133.8 million for Project Pelax. The renewal with Zoraelix Systems closes at $61.9 million a year, 12.7 percent above the last contract.

## Blue-green cutover — Tollgrange billing worker

Promote green only after the reconciliation lag drops below thirty seconds. Both colors share the ledger database but must never share a payment-gateway credential, or duplicate charges can occur. Before flipping traffic, open the green worker's env file and append the following line.

sealed setting: ARCHIVE_KEY3=8d0

Ticket #4471: The credentials used by the Lokafix date-localization worker expired overnight, which is why regional date formats on Brindlewave invoices reverted to ISO defaults. Support should advise affected customers that a fix is deploying within the hour. To verify the patched worker locally, use the replacement key issued this morning, shown below.

gateway credential: kto23_LX9A4ys6i4nzHtpOLNLodKK